Software development for multi-level petri net based design inference network
Çok katmanlı petri net tabanlı tasarım-çıkarım ağı için algoritma geliştirilmesi
- Tez No: 153509
- Danışmanlar: PROF. DR. ABDÜLKADİR ERDEN
- Tez Türü: Yüksek Lisans
- Konular: Makine Mühendisliği, Mechanical Engineering
- Anahtar Kelimeler: Tasarım Ağı Benzetimcisi (DNS), Petri Net, Modülerlik, İşlevsel Tasarım, Mekatronik Tasarım vii, Design Network Simulator (DNS), Petri Net, Modularity, Functional Decomposition, Mechatronic Design
- Yıl: 2004
- Dil: İngilizce
- Üniversite: Orta Doğu Teknik Üniversitesi
- Enstitü: Fen Bilimleri Enstitüsü
- Ana Bilim Dalı: Makine Mühendisliği Ana Bilim Dalı
- Bilim Dalı: Belirtilmemiş.
- Sayfa Sayısı: 135
Özet
ÖZ ÇOK KATMANLI PETRI NET TABANLI TASARIM-ÇIKARIM AGI İÇİN ALGORİTMA GELİŞTİRİLMESİ COŞKUN, Çağdaş M.S., Department of Mechanical Engineering Supervisor : Prof. Dr.Abdülkadir ERDEN Temmuz 2004, 118 Sayfa Bu tezde düğümleri PNDN modülleriyle modellenmiş çok katmanlı, eş zamanlı bir tasarım çıkarım ağının bilgisayar uygulaması sunulmaktadır. Bu tasarım ağı PNDN modüllerinden oluşan ağ anlamında N-PNDN olarak adlandırılmıştır ve PNDN ağının içine gömülmüş pek çok PNDN modülünden oluşmakta olup, bir mühendislik tasarımında kavramsal tasarım otomasyonunu kolaylaştırmak amacıyla bilgi akışı fonksiyonel temelde modellenmiştir. N-PNDN'de bilgi akışı üst ve alt PNDN modülleri arasında gerçekleşmektedir, bu sebeple yapı hiyerarşiktir. Modüller arası bilgi akışı simge akışı ile gösterilmektedir. Bu tez çalışmasında çok katmanlı tasarım- çıkanm ağının kurulması ve bu ağdaki bilgi akışının bilgisayar uygulaması yeniden yapılandırılmıştır. Bu nedenle, bir önceki Petri net tabanlı tasarım viçıkarım ağı için geliştirilen algoritma, mekatronik ürünlerin çok katmanlı ve işlevsel tasarımına imkan verecek hale getirilmiştir. İlgili algoritmalar bir nesneye yönelik görsel programlama ortamı kullanılarak tamamlanmıştır. Buna ek olarak grafik kullanıcı arayüzü de son yapılan değişikliklere uygun hale getirilmiştir. Geliştirilmiş DNS, 5 mekatronik sistemin kavramsal tasarımında N-PNDN mimarisinin uygulaması için kullanılmıştır. Bu çalışmaların sonucunda, DNS 'in tasarımcılar arasındaki fikir alışverişini kolaylaştıran, görsel zeminde detaylı bir arayüz sunduğu gözlemlenmiştir.
Özet (Çeviri)
ABSTRACT SOFTWARE DEVELOPMENT FOR MULTI-LEVEL PETRI NET BASED DESIGN INFERENCE NETWORK COŞKUN, Çağdaş M.S., Department of Mechanical Engineering Supervisor : Prof. Dr. Abdülkadir ERDEN July 2004, 118 Pages This thesis presents the computer implementation of a multi resolutional concurrent, design inference network, whose nodes are refined by PNDN (Petri Net Based Design Inference Network) modules. The extended design network is named as N-PNDN and consists of several embedded PNDN modules which models the information flow on a functional basis to facilitate the design automation at the conceptual design phase of an engineering design. Information flow in N-PNDN occurs between parent and child PNDN modules in a hierarchical structure and is provided by the token flow between the modules. In this study, computer implementation of the design network construction and token flow algorithms for the N-PNDN structure is restored and therefore the previous DNS (Design Network Simulator) is adapted for the multi layer design and decomposition of mechatronic IVproducts. The related algorithms are developed by using an object oriented, visual programming environment. The graphical user interface is also modified. The further developed DNS has been used for the application of the N-PNDN structure in the conceptual design of 5 mechatronic systems. In the guidance of this study, it has been understood that the further developed DNS is a powerful tool for designers coming from different engineering disciplines in order to interchange their ideas.
Benzer Tezler
- Optimum yenilenebilir enerji sistemlerinin tasarımı için yazılım geliştirme
Software development for the design of optimum renewable energy systems
BURAK BEHLÜL ÖLMEZ
Yüksek Lisans
Türkçe
2024
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olSelçuk 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
DR. ÖĞR. ÜYESİ GÜL NİHAL GÜĞÜL
- A platform for agent behaviour design and multi agent orchestration
Multi ajanların koordinasyonu ve davranışlarının tanımlanması için bir platform
GÖKÇE BANU LALECİ
Yüksek Lisans
İngilizce
2003
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olOrta Doğu Teknik 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
PROF. DR. ASUMAN DOĞAÇ
- An extensible modeling approach and implementation for rapid application development
Çevik uygulama geliştirme için genişletilebilir bir modelleme yaklaşımı
HAKAN DİLEK
Yüksek Lisans
İngilizce
2006
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olMarmara 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
PROF. DR. AKİF EYLER
- Çoklu otonom insansız hava araçları için paralel programlama tabanlı yol planlaması
Parallel programming based path planning for multi autonomous unmmaned vehicles
ÖMER ÇETİN
Doktora
Türkçe
2015
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olHava Harp Okulu KomutanlığıBilgisayar Mühendisliği Ana Bilim Dalı
DOÇ. DR. GÜRAY YILMAZ
- Intelligent agents based simulation using Jack development environment
Jack geliştirme ortamında kullanarak akıllı etmenler tabanlı benzetim
ÇAĞATAY ÇATAL
Yüksek Lisans
İngilizce
2004
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rolİstanbul Teknik 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
DOÇ.DR. COŞKUN SÖNMEZ